2 lines
3.3 KiB
JavaScript
2 lines
3.3 KiB
JavaScript
|
import{d as v,r as _,b as w,o as h,c as g,k as s,m as o,t,y as n,K as r,e as a,x as y,R as N,_ as C}from"./index-ce293e15.js";import{E as P}from"./el-row-12f29e15.js";import{E as T,a as k}from"./el-tab-pane-07786f74.js";import{E as U}from"./el-col-6a25bef6.js";import{E as $}from"./el-card-d5e24325.js";import A from"./userAvatar-085c6d13.js";import{_ as B}from"./userInfo.vue_vue_type_script_setup_true_lang-c79dc3c5.js";import{_ as R}from"./resetPwd.vue_vue_type_script_setup_true_lang-90503daa.js";import{_ as D,g as F}from"./thirdParty.vue_vue_type_style_index_0_lang-540c561d.js";import{g as K}from"./index-b6caa659.js";import"./strings-d88802bc.js";import"./el-upload-f5a4cf25.js";import"./el-progress-b748f709.js";import"./_baseClone-e976708f.js";import"./_Uint8Array-e8d4eb20.js";import"./_initCloneObject-d640be41.js";import"./isEqual-48984780.js";import"./el-form-item-16067f4c.js";/* empty css *//* empty css */import"./index-142ddad2.js";import"./el-table-column-cabb178a.js";import"./el-checkbox-4dcbb825.js";import"./el-tag-3fc9a3c5.js";const L={class:"p-2"},M=t("div",{class:"clearfix"},[t("span",null,"个人信息")],-1),S={class:"text-center"},j={class:"list-group list-group-striped"},q={class:"list-group-item"},z={class:"pull-right"},H={class:"list-group-item"},I={class:"pull-right"},J={class:"list-group-item"},O={class:"pull-right"},Q={class:"list-group-item"},W={key:0,class:"pull-right"},X={class:"list-group-item"},Y={class:"pull-right"},Z={class:"list-group-item"},ss={class:"pull-right"},ts=t("div",{class:"clearfix"},[t("span",null,"基本资料")],-1),es=v({name:"Profile"}),Ps=v({...es,setup(os){const c=_("userinfo"),e=_({user:{},roleGroup:"",postGroup:"",auths:[]}),p=_({}),b=async()=>{const l=await K();e.value.user=l.data.user,p.value={...l.data.user},e.value.roleGroup=l.data.roleGroup,e.value.postGroup=l.data.postGroup},x=async()=>{const l=await F();e.value.auths=l.data};return w(()=>{b(),x()}),(l,m)=>{const i=C,d=$,f=U,u=T,E=k,G=P;return h(),g("div",L,[s(G,{gutter:20},{default:o(()=>[s(f,{span:6,xs:24},{default:o(()=>[s(d,{class:"box-card"},{header:o(()=>[M]),default:o(()=>[t("div",null,[t("div",S,[s(A)]),t("ul",j,[t("li",q,[s(i,{"icon-class":"user"}),n("用户名称 "),t("div",z,r(a(e).user.userName),1)]),t("li",H,[s(i,{"icon-class":"phone"}),n("手机号码 "),t("div",I,r(a(e).user.phonenumber),1)]),t("li",J,[s(i,{"icon-class":"email"}),n("用户邮箱 "),t("div",O,r(a(e).user.email),1)]),t("li",Q,[s(i,{"icon-class":"tree"}),n("所属部门 "),a(e).user.dept?(h(),g("div",W,r(a(e).user.dept.deptName)+" / "+r(a(e).postGroup),1)):y("",!0)]),t("li",X,[s(i,{"icon-class":"peoples"}),n("所属角色 "),t("div",Y,r(a(e).roleGroup),1)]),t("li",Z,[s(i,{"icon-class":"date"}),n("创建日期 "),t("div",ss,r(a(e).user.createTime),1)])])])]),_:1})]),_:1}),s(f,{span:18,xs:24},{default:o(()=>[s(d,null,{header:o(()=>[ts]),default:o(()=>[s(E,{modelValue:a(c),"onUpdate:modelValue":m[0]||(m[0]=V=>N(c)?c.value=V:null)},{default:o(()=>[s(u,{label:"基本资料",name:"userinfo"},{default:o(()=>[s(B,{user:a(p)},null,8,["user"])]),_:1}),s(u,{label:"修改密码",name:"resetPwd"},{default:o(()=>[s(R)]),_:1}),s(u,{label:"第三方应用",name:"thirdParty"},{default:o(()=>[s(D,{auths:a(e).auths},null,8,["auths"])]),_:1})]),_:1},8,["modelValue"])]),_:1})]),_:1})]),_:1})])}}});export{Ps as default};
|